Subject: usb: host: xhci_debugfs: Fix a null pointer dereference in xhci_debugfs_create_endpoint()
Date: Sat, 4 May 2019 08:33:40 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190504063340.GA26311@kroah.com> (raw)
On Sat, May 04, 2019 at 11:37:48AM +0800, Jia-Ju Bai wrote:
> In xhci_debugfs_create_slot(), kzalloc() can fail and
> dev->debugfs_private will be NULL.
> In xhci_debugfs_create_endpoint(), dev->debugfs_private is used without
> any null-pointer check, and can cause a null pointer dereference.
>
> To fix this bug, a null-pointer check is added in
> xhci_debugfs_create_endpoint().
>
> This bug is found by a runtime fuzzing tool named FIZZER written by us.
>
> Signed-off-by: Jia-Ju Bai <baijiaju1990@gmail.com>
Very rare case, but nice fix. You should put "potential" in your
subject line as this is something that no one should ever hit :)
Anyway:
Reviewed-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org>
